Who We AreDALB, Inc. is a West Virginia-based manufacturer with more than 40 years of experience serving our industry (printing, thermoforming & fabrication). We’re a hard-working, humble, and close-knit team that values accountability, humility, and long-term commitment. Our workplace culture is rooted in family values, hands-on problem-solving, and an entrepreneurial mindset that drives continuous improvement.
Summary/Objective: A Small Format Fabrication position is responsible for wrapping parts, counting parts, operating manual equipment, running the pouch laminator, and other tasks as assigned in the small format department.
Essential Functions:
Counting and shrink wrapping parts
Die cutting
Assembly
Read and understand manufacturing orders and the dispatch list.
Know machine settings to maintain a quality product
Fill out and understand the Scrap and internal usage form Assists with other fabrication steps when required
Ensure all equipment and tools are in good working order and are free of safety hazards.
Regular attendance and the ability to work overtime as needed.
Communicates safety and maintenance issues to supervisor
Must wear the required safety equipment
Stand for long periods of time
Meet or exceed production goals
